Ravers party and then tidy site
About 700 people attended an illegal rave over the weekend, police said.

Kent officers said the rave started on Saturday at Kingswood and wound down at about 1000 GMT on Sunday, with the last people leaving the site that evening.

Police said they attended the area every 90 minutes during the event. Some youths were reported as loitering but caused no problems, said a spokesman.

Organisers tidied the site, while parked vehicles led to problems but were passable with care, police said.

A spokesman said a group of up to 15 youths were reported to be loitering in a pub car park on Sunday morning, but officers found they were using the area as a meeting point.

He said the site owner and residents were satisfied at the way the police handled the situation.
